What is custom branding in Loom?

Custom branding in Loom is a feature that allows users to personalize their videos with their own brand elements. This can include adding a company logo, using specific brand colors, or incorporating other unique identifiers that represent the business. The aim of custom branding is to create a consistent and recognizable brand image across all videos, enhancing the professional appearance and credibility of the content.

This feature is particularly beneficial for businesses as it helps to increase brand awareness and recognition among viewers. By consistently presenting the same branding elements, viewers can easily associate the videos with the company, which can contribute to building a strong brand identity. Custom branding in Loom also allows businesses to stand out from competitors by showcasing their unique brand personality and style.

How to add custom branding in Loom?

To add custom branding in Loom, you need to have a Loom Pro, Team, or Enterprise account. Once you have one of these accounts, you can add your custom branding by going to your account settings. From there, navigate to the 'Branding' section. Here, you can upload your company logo and choose a color that matches your brand. The logo will appear in the top right corner of your videos and the color will be used for the progress bar and the call-to-action button.

After you've uploaded your logo and chosen your color, make sure to click 'Save Changes' to apply your custom branding. Now, whenever you record a video using Loom, your custom branding will be automatically applied. This feature helps to give your videos a more professional look and feel, and can help to increase brand recognition among your viewers.

Can I customize my Loom videos with my own branding?

Yes, you can customize your Loom videos with your own branding. Loom offers a variety of customization options that allow you to personalize your videos to match your brand. This includes the ability to add your own logo, choose your own color schemes, and even add custom thumbnails to your videos.

However, it's important to note that some of these features may only be available with certain Loom plans. For instance, the ability to add your own logo might be a feature that's only available to users with a Pro or Business plan. Therefore, you should check the specific features of your Loom plan to see what customization options are available to you.
